Steps for Configuring Dual Internet Services

  • Choose the Right Router: Ensure your router supports multiple WAN (Wide Area Network) connections. This will allow you to connect both internet services simultaneously without conflicts.
  • Use Separate Network Channels: If you are using Wi-Fi, select distinct frequency bands (e.g., 2.4 GHz for one network and 5 GHz for the other) to avoid interference.
  • Configure Load Balancing: Many modern routers allow for load balancing, which evenly distributes internet traffic between both services to prevent overload on one connection.

Steps to Fix Common Network Problems

  1. Check IP Conflicts: Ensure that both routers are using different IP address ranges. For example, set one router to use the range 192.168.0.x and the other to use 192.168.1.x.
  2. Optimize Router Placement: Place routers in central locations to minimize interference and improve coverage.
  3. Update Firmware: Make sure that both routers are using the latest firmware, as updates can resolve security vulnerabilities and improve performance.
  4. Test Both Connections: Use speed tests to check if both internet connections are working properly and not competing for bandwidth.

Important Note

If you're using a device like a dual-WAN router, make sure to configure the load balancing settings properly. Without correct setup, one network might consume all available bandwidth, leaving the other network practically useless.

Traffic Distribution Strategies

  • Load Balancing: This method splits traffic evenly across both internet services. It can be done manually by configuring routers to send specific types of traffic to one service and others to the second service.
  • Failover Mode: In this setup, one internet connection acts as a backup in case the primary connection fails. This ensures that there is no downtime, though bandwidth is not maximized during regular use.
  • Quality of Service (QoS) Rules: Assigning priority to certain types of data (such as streaming or gaming) ensures that high-demand applications receive sufficient bandwidth, even if the internet connection is shared between multiple users.

Effective Load Balancing

Load balancing ensures that data traffic is distributed evenly across both internet connections. By doing so, you can prevent one connection from becoming overwhelmed, which could lead to slow speeds or outages. Implementing a load balancer will route traffic based on the current load of each connection.

  • Active-Active Mode: Both connections are used simultaneously, sharing the traffic load.
  • Active-Passive Mode: One connection serves as a primary, with the other serving as a backup in case of failure.
  • Round-Robin Balancing: Traffic is distributed evenly, with each connection taking turns handling requests.
